CRICKET.

AUSTRALIA v. OTAGO. (Per Press Association.) . DUNEDIN, March-8, The weather is fine for the crickcr match. though there was a slight shower in the forenoon. Bardsley and Mayno opened Australian's second innings to the bowling of Cummings and MacArtnoy. Bardsley had made 17 and Mayne 7 at 2.30.
